## Authentication

Reviewer notes for the Cartwheel dispatch service. The driver-assignment heuristic endpoints (/assign, /rebalance) are internal-only and sit behind the gateway. All calls require a bearer token; no cookie auth, no API keys. Tokens are short-lived (15 min) and minted by authd — don't approve any change that caches them longer. Test fixtures in /tests/heuristic use a static sandbox token so scoring runs are reproducible. If you want to exercise the endpoints locally while reviewing, use the sandbox token below.

bearer token for bahip-tajeg: eyJhbGciOiJIUzI1NiIsInR5cCI6IkpXVCJ9.eyJzdWIiOiI1L7f3gIn0.wcG2mhGD

Subject: Cut-over complete — Lintgate baseline

Team,

The static-analysis cut-over for the Ospreyline service finished last night. We regenerated the baseline file against the new ruleset, suppressing 412 pre-existing findings so only new issues fail the pipeline. Legacy suppressions were dropped; anything reintroduced will surface as new. Marit verified the diff and the gate ran clean on three trial branches. Baseline file is committed and locked behind review. For audit purposes, the scanner's active configuration is reproduced below.

config for fahap-badup:
[ralath]
port = 3000
region = lower-2
host = ralath.tolvaqsys.corp
timeout_ms = 3000
retries = 4

**Key Ceremony Checklist — Item 7 (Audit-Log Viewer)**

After the Glintrow audit-log viewer keys are generated, the support team verifies read access to the sealed archive partition. Two ceremony witnesses must initial this step. If the viewer refuses the new keys on first mount, it will prompt for recovery; the passphrase to enter is below.

recovery phrase for bawef-haduf: wenax-druox-julmir

## Spooler restart — Pressgate service

If jobs stall on the Pressgate spooler, check queue depth first: `pressctl queue --depth`. Over 500, drain before restarting. Restart with `systemctl restart pressgate-spooler` on the Harlow cluster nodes only; never on edge nodes. Verify health at `/internal/healthz` within two minutes. All `pressctl` commands require authentication against the Doorlatch admin API; contractors use the shared ops credential. Paste the following key into your `PRESSCTL_TOKEN` environment variable before running anything.

API key for tahaf-fahag: zpat23_VG35ddrlC6MXnbjrwSkCOM9